Expected behaviour
Weeell, do not output CR on Linux.
Actual behaviour
Weeell, outputs CR character on Linux.
$ LC_ALL=C checkmake --format={{.LineNumber}}:{{.Rule}}:{{.Violation}} /tmp/Makefile | head -n1 | hexdump -C
00000000 30 3a 6d 69 6e 70 68 6f 6e 79 3a 4d 69 73 73 69 |0:minphony:Missi|
00000010 6e 67 20 72 65 71 75 69 72 65 64 20 70 68 6f 6e |ng required phon|
00000020 79 20 74 61 72 67 65 74 20 22 61 6c 6c 22 0d 0a |y target "all"..|
# ^^ HERE

So I was trying to integrate checkmake with https://github.com/iamcco/coc-diagnostic, spend good 2 hours figuring why it does not work. Seems like coc-diagnostic does not like CR characters (which I will tr -d '\'r fix on my config side) but I believe *unix tools shouldn't output CR characters anyway. I tried reading the source code, but I know nothing about go, so I do not know where to fix.
